aboutsummaryrefslogtreecommitdiffstats
path: root/src/vnet/interface.api
diff options
context:
space:
mode:
authorNeale Ranns <nranns@cisco.com>2018-03-21 09:44:01 -0400
committerChris Luke <chris_luke@comcast.com>2018-03-21 20:22:27 +0000
commit0cae3f737fcbfbef364fb8237faee08842f3fb68 (patch)
tree6c43fb7702c6919ae0496a0bdec09bf69ec4366e /src/vnet/interface.api
parent1cbb19f59fd5f03cc7f368a9f8ad91485d04962b (diff)
Detailed Interface stats API takes sw_if_index
Change-Id: Id09d777c1706c1d613b14b719bcac596194465cd Signed-off-by: Neale Ranns <nranns@cisco.com>
Diffstat (limited to 'src/vnet/interface.api')
-rw-r--r--src/vnet/interface.api5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/vnet/interface.api b/src/vnet/interface.api
index 4d1b5ac06de..25ba70342ee 100644
--- a/src/vnet/interface.api
+++ b/src/vnet/interface.api
@@ -544,13 +544,16 @@ autoreply define delete_loopback
/** \brief Enable or disable detailed interface stats
@param client_index - opaque cookie to identify the sender
@param context - sender context, to match reply w/ request
+ @param sw_if_index - The interface to collect detail stats on. ~0 implies
+ all interfaces.
@param enable_disable - set to 1 to enable, 0 to disable detailed stats
*/
autoreply define collect_detailed_interface_stats
{
u32 client_index;
u32 context;
- u8 enable_disable;
+ u32 sw_if_index;
+ u8 enable_disable;
};
/*